Elgin Manuel Puaimoku Duarte, 85, of Kailua, a retired Army sergeant major, died at home. He was born in Hakalau, Hawaii.

He is survived by wife Joyce C. Hunter; sons Matthew Duarte and Scott and Kenneth Lawton; daughter Cindy Lwin; sisters Elaine Hara and Ethel Morimoto; and seven grandchildren.

Committal services: 10 a.m. Friday at Hawaii State Veterans Cemetery. Luncheon to follow.

Source: Honolulu Star-Advertiser, August 17, 2014.
